Chomping down and chowing: Caterpillar seen in time lapse, widfilmsindia Jabbarkhet in the Himalaya

Chomping down and chowing: Caterpillar seen in time lapse, widfilmsindia Jabbarkhet in the Himalaya04:08

Informasi unduhan dan detail video Chomping down and chowing: Caterpillar seen in time lapse, widfilmsindia Jabbarkhet in the Himalaya

Pengunggah:

WildFilmsIndia

Diterbitkan pada:

12/5/2025

Penayangan:

254